OptiBiotix receives British Retail Consortium accreditation

Wed, 05th Jan 2022 15:31

(Alliance News) - OptiBiotix Health PLC announced on Wednesday it had obtained accreditation from the British Retail Consortium, allowing the company to do business with large global retailers.

The BRC certification is the first to meet the Global Food Safety Initiative, enabling the life sciences company to do business with retailers such as Tesco PLC and Walmart Inc.

In addition, it may now sell to other large manufacturers, ingredient companies, and food service organizations who require the certification in their approval process.

Rene Kamminga, chief executive officer of York-based ObtiBiotix, commented: "We are very pleased to announce our BRC accreditation which supports our commercial strategy of selling final product solutions to partners in the retail channel containing our science backed pro and prebiotic ingredients. I am particularly proud of our team which achieved this accreditation in a relatively short period of time."

The life sciences company's share price fell by 2.7% to 45.23 pence each in London on Wednesday afternoon.
